body {
	background-color: #fff; 
	font-size: 12pt;
	font-family: helvetica, arial, sans-serif, verdana;
	word-spacing: 1px; 
	text-align: left;  
	padding: 0; 
	min-width: 267px;      			/* 2x (col_left fullwidth + col_center padding) + col_right fullwidth */
	width: 800px;
	height: 100%; 
	margin: auto;
}

#Header	{ 
	background-color: transparent;		 
	width: 800px; 
	height: 125px; 
	margin: 0; 
	padding: 0; 
	border: none; 
	position: absolute; 
}

#container {
  	padding-left: 15px;   			/* col_left fullwidth */
  	padding-right: 220px;  			/* col_right fullwidth + col_center padding */
	padding-top: 125px;
}
#container .column {
	position: relative;
  	float: left;
}
#col_center {
	height: 100%;
	min-height: 600px;
  	width: 100%;
	padding: 5px 12px 0 5px;    	/* col_center padding */
  	
}
#col_left {
  	height: 100%;
	min-height: 600px;
	width: 15px;          			/* col_left width */
  	padding: 5px 0 0 0;       		/* col_left padding */
  	right: 32px;          			/* col_left fullwidth + col_center padding */
  	margin-left: -100%;
}
#col_right {
	height: 100%;
	min-height: 600px;
  	width: 193px;          			/* col_right width */
  	padding: 5px 10px 0 0;       	/* col_right padding */
  	margin-right: -220px;  			/* col_right fullwidth + col_center padding */
}

#Footer {
	text-align: center; 
  	clear: both;
	padding: 0;
	margin: 0;
}

#container_contact { 
	margin: 5px 0; 
	padding: 5px 0; 
	width: 185px; 
	height: 75px; 
	position: relative; 
	float: right; 
	border: none;
}

div.container_web { 
	margin: 5px 0; 
	padding: 0; 
	width: 100%; 
	height: 160px;  
	position: relative; 
	float: left;
	color: #333; 
	font-style: italic;
	margin: 0; 
	padding: 5px 15px 0 0;	
}

h1.left { 
	color: #000; 
	height: 18px; 
	background-color: #fff; 
	font-style: normal; 
	font-weight: 400; 
	font-size: 10pt; 
	line-height: 11pt; 
	margin: 10px 0 0; 
	padding: 0; 
	border-bottom: 2px solid #cc9;
}



h1.right {
	color: #000; 
	height: 18px;
	font-style: normal; 
	font-weight: 400; 
	font-size: 10pt; 
	line-height: 11pt; 
	margin: 10px 10px 0 0; 
	padding: 0;  
	border-bottom: 2px solid #cc0;
}
			
h1.nav	{
	color: #000; 
	height: 16px; 
	background-color: transparent; 
	font-style: normal; 
	font-weight: 400; 
	font-size: 10pt; 
	line-height: 11pt;
	margin: 10px 10px 0 0; 
	padding: 0;
	border-bottom: 2px solid #cc0;
	position: relative;
}

h2.left { 
	color: #333; 
	height: 16px; 
	background-color: #fff; 
	font-style: normal; 
	font-weight: 400; 
	font-size: 9pt; 
	line-height: 10pt; 
	margin: 0; 
	padding: 0;
}

p.artist	{ 
	color: #333; 
	font-weight: 700; 
	font-size: 9pt; 
	line-height: 10pt;
	width: 100% ;  
	margin: 5px 0; 
	padding: 0; 
}

p.title		{
	color: #333; 
	font-weight:  400; 
	font-style: italic; 
	font-size: 9pt; 
	line-height: 10pt; 
	width: 100%;  
	margin: 5px 0; 
	padding: 0; 
	}

p.profile	{ 
	color: #333; 
	font-weight: 400; 
	font-size: 9pt; 
	line-height: 10pt;
	text-align: justify; 
	margin: 5px 0 0; 
	padding: 5px 15px 0 0;
	}

p.disclaimer	{ 
	color: #333; 
	font-weight: 400; 
	font-size: 9pt; 
	line-height: 10pt; 
	text-align: justify;
	margin: 0 0 10px; 
	padding: 5px 15px 0 0; 
	position: absolute; 
	float: left; 
	bottom: 0;  
	}

p.testimonial 	{ 
	color: #333; 
	font-style: italic; 
	font-size: 9pt; 
	line-height: 10pt;  
	margin: 0; 
	padding: 5px 15px 0;
	}

p.caption 	{ 
	color: #333; 
	font-style: normal; 
	font-size: 8pt; 
	line-height: 8pt; 
	width: 500px; 
	height: 10px; 
	text-align: left; 
	margin: 0; 
	padding: 5px 0; 
	}

p.contact	{ 	
	background-color: #fff;
	width: 800px; 
	height: 15px;
	color: #333;
	font-size: 10pt; 
	line-height: 10pt; 
	text-align: right;
	}
				
div.float {		
	float: left;
	margin-top: 0;
	margin-right: 15px;
	margin-bottom: 15px;
	margin-left: 0;
	}			
			
div.blog	{ 
	background-color: #fff; 
	margin: 0; 
	padding: 10px 0 10px 0;
	}

p.blog		{ 
	color: #333; 
	font-weight: 400; 
	font-size: 9pt; 
	line-height: 11pt; 
	text-align: justify;
	margin: 0; 
	padding: 10px 15px 10px 0;
	}

ul.contact		{ 
	color: #333; 
	font-weight: 500; 
	font-size: 9pt;  
	line-height: 11pt;  
	text-align: right; 
	width: 170px; 
	word-spacing: 1px; 
	margin: 0; 
	padding: 0; 
	list-style: none;
	}

ul 		{ 
	color: #333;  
	font-size: 10pt; 
	line-height: 12pt; 
	width: 500px; 
	height: 75px; 
	margin: 0; 
	padding: 0;s
	}

img.profile 	{ 
	background-color: #fff; 
	margin: 5px 0 0; 
	padding: 0; 
	border: none; 
	float: left; 
	}

img.contact 	{ 
	background-color: #fff; 
	margin: 5px 0 0; 
	padding: 0; 
	border: none; 
	float: right; 
	}

img.project	{ 
	background-color: transparent; 
	margin: 0; 
	padding: 0; 
	top: 0; 
	border: none; 
	float: left; 
	}
	
img.review	{ 
	border: 1px solid #cc9; 
	}

.journalimg {
	margin-top: 10px;
	margin-right: 0;
	margin-bottom: 10px;
	color: #333;  
	font-size: 8pt; 
	line-height: 10pt; 
	width: 500px;  
}

#divControl img { 
	margin: 0; 
	border-top: none; 
	border-right: 1px #fff solid;
	border-bottom: 1px #fff solid; 
	border-left: none; 
	position: relative; 
	}

#divCont img { 
	margin: 0; 
	border: 1px solid #cc9; 
	position: relative 
	}

hr { 
	background-color: #fff; 
	margin: 0 15px 0 0; 
	padding: 0; 
	border: 0; 
	border-bottom: 1px dotted #cc9; 
	height: 0;
	clear: both;
}

a.gallery:active { 
	color: #000; 
	height: 16px;
	width: 183px;
	font-size: 10pt; 
	line-height: 10pt;
	margin: 12px 0 0; 
	padding: 0;
	border-bottom: 2px solid #cc0;
	position: relative;
	width: 183px;
	display:inline-block; 
	display:-moz-inline-box;
	}
	
a.gallery:link {
	border-bottom-width: 183px;
	color: #000; 
	height: 16px;
	width: 183px;
	font-style: normal; 
	font-weight: 400; 
	font-size: 10pt; 
	line-height: 10pt;
	margin: 12px 0 0; 
	padding: 0;
	border-bottom: 2px solid #cc0;
	position: relative;
	width: 183px; 
	display:inline-block; 
	display:-moz-inline-box;
	}
	
a.gallery:visited { 
	color: #000; 
	height: 16px;
	font-style: normal; 
	font-weight: 400;  
	font-size: 10pt; 
	line-height: 10pt;
	margin: 12px 0 0; 
	padding: 0; 
	border-bottom: 2px solid #cc0;
	position: relative;
	width: 183px; 
	display:inline-block; 
	display:-moz-inline-box;
	}
	
a.gallery:hover 	{
	border: 183px;
	color: #cc0; 
	height: 16px; 
	font-style: normal; 
	font-weight: 400; 
	font-size: 10pt; 
	line-height: 10pt;
	margin: 12px 0 0; 
	padding: 0;
	border-bottom: 2px solid #cc0;
	width: 183px;
	display:inline-block; 
	display:-moz-inline-box;	
	}
	
input 	{
 	background-color: #fff;
 	color: #000;
 	border: 1px dotted #cc9;
	}

textarea 	{
 	background-color: #fff;
 	color: #000;
 	border: 1px dotted #cc9;
	}

a	{ 
	color: #000;  
	font-weight: 400; 
	font-size: 9pt; 
	line-height: 10pt; 
	text-decoration: none; 
	margin: 0; 
	padding: 0; 
	border: 0; 
	}
		
a:link, a:visited     { 
	color: #000;  
	font-weight: 600; 
	font-size: 9pt; 
	line-height: 10pt; 
	text-decoration: none; 
	margin: 0; 
	padding: 0; 
	border: 0; 
	}
	

a:active    { 
	color: #000;  
	font-weight: 600; 
	font-size: 9pt; 
	line-height: 10pt; 
	text-decoration: none; 
	margin: 0; 
	padding: 0; 
	border: 0; 
}
	
a:hover     {
	color: #cc0;  
	font-weight: 600; 
	font-size: 9pt; 
	line-height: 10pt; 
	text-decoration: none; 
	margin: 0; 
	padding: 0; 
	border: 0; 
}



* html #left {
  left: 150px;  /* RC width */
}


#nav {
	background-image: url(media/navbar_background.jpg);
	background-position: inherit;
	background-repeat: no-repeat;	
	border: none;
	width: 800px;
	height: 25px; 
	padding: 2px 0 0 20px;
	list-style: none;
	float: left;
}

a.nav {
	font-family: helvetica, arial, sans-serif, verdana;
	padding: 3px;
	margin: 1px 1px;
	font-size: 11pt; 
	line-height: 11pt;
	font-style: normal;
	font-weight: 400;
	word-spacing: 5px;
	display: block;
}

a.nav:link, a.nav:visited	{ 
	color: #fff;
	font-weight: 400;
	text-decoration: none;
}
 
a.nav:hover         { 
	color: #cc0;
	font-weight: 400;
	text-decoration: none; 
}

a.nav:active        { 
	color: #fff;
	font-weight: 400; 
	text-decoration: none; 
}

#nav ul {
	padding: 0;
	margin: 0;
	list-style: none;
}


#nav li {  
	padding: 0 5px 0 0;
	float: left;
	width: auto;
}

#nav li ul {
	position: absolute;
	width: auto;
}

#nav li:hover ul {
	left: auto;
}

#nav li:hover ul, #nav li.sfhover ul {
	left: auto;
}


